1937 Soda Bread

0
(0)
CATEGORY CUISINE TAG YIELD
Dairy Heritage 1 Servings

INGREDIENTS

1 t Baking soda
1 t Salt
1 t Cream of tartar
1 t Sugar
Flour
Sour milk or buttermilk

INSTRUCTIONS

Combine the first 4 ingredients and then rub them through a sieve. For
making white soda bread use 1/2 of the soda mizture to 1 Cup of  flour.
Then mix as a soft drop dough with sour milk. Pour into a  well-greased
pan and bake in a 450 oven for 12 minutes. For Brown  Soda Bread use 1
cup of whole wheat flour and 1/2 C white flour with  3/4 tsp. of the
soda mixture and bake as above.  *When the original knob on your tea
